8.15.15 Carolina Clash Late Models Results

Chris Ferguson of Mount Holly, North Carolina took home the victory Saturday night August 15th at Smoky Mountain Speedway in the Carolina Clash Super Late Model Series event worth $5,000. Mark Douglas, Jeff Wolfenbarger, Billy Ogle Jr., and Roger Best rounded out the top five finishers. Smoky Mountain Speedway Results…

8.11.15 Carolina Clash Late Models Results

Chris Ferguson of Mount Holly, North Carolina took home the victory Tuesday night August 11th at Carolina Speedway in the Carolina Clash Super Late Model Series 43rd Annual Gaston Shrine Club Benefit event. Dennis Franklin, Ben Watkins, Greg Clark, and Doug Sanders rounded out the top five finishers. Carolina Speedway…
